A rope of length L and uniform linear density is hanging from the ceiling. A transverse wave pulse, generated close to the free end of the rope, travels upwards through the rope. Select the correct option.

Options

  1. AThe speed of the pulse decreases as it moves up.
  2. BThe time taken by the pulse to travel the length of the rope is proportional to L .
  3. CThe tension will be constant along the length of the rope.
  4. DThe speed of the pulse will be constant along the length of the rope.

Correct answer

B. The time taken by the pulse to travel the length of the rope is proportional to L .

Step-by-step solution

Tension at a section x distance from free end is T = m g = μ · x · g where, μ = mass per unit length of rope. Wave speed over the rope is given by v = T μ = μ · x · g μ = g · x ⇒ v 2 = g x Comparing above equation with v 2 - u 2 = 2 a s , we get ⇒ v 2 = 2 a x = g x ⇒ Acceleration, a = g 2 Now, if t = time for wave pulse to cover a distance x , then from s = u t + 1 2 a t 2 , we have x = 1 2 × g 2 × t 2 or t = 2 x g ⇒ t ∝ x or time to travel complete length of rope t ∝ L .
